1. Being a Dik

Being a Dik is a prime example of a game that successfully captures the spirit of Summertime Saga. This game emphasizes heavily on the narrative-driven gameplay experience. With a deep story, memorable characters, and a branching narrative where your choices truly matter, it has a lot of qualities similar to the original. The game’s college setting provides a familiar backdrop and a lot of the same relationship-building mechanics found in Summertime Saga. Being a Dik also features adult content, though it's not the sole focus. It's more integrated into the story and character development, adding to the overall experience. The adult content in this game is more immersive to the gameplay, and does not seem out of place. This game really stands out because of the well-written characters, story, and choices that affect the game. Being a Dik is available on PC, Mac, and Linux, making it easy to access for a wide audience. It is a fantastic alternative for those who like the gameplay of Summertime Saga. 2. House Party

If you want a game that focuses more on the interactive experience, then House Party might be for you. House Party is a 3D adult game. The players can interact with each other and the environment. You can explore a variety of social interactions, and relationship building is key, with plenty of opportunities to get involved in some raunchy situations. Unlike Summertime Saga, House Party places a stronger emphasis on social interaction and freedom, and allows players to make their own choices. The game's open-ended nature allows players to explore different scenarios and outcomes, making it a great choice for those who want a more hands-on experience. House Party has a wide array of adult content, from simple interactions to more complex scenes. The gameplay is the main focus, unlike Summertime Saga where the story is more important. The game's humor, combined with its detailed characters, has earned it a large and active fanbase. If you enjoy games with freedom, you will likely love House Party.

3. Paradise Lust

Paradise Lust offers a distinctive tropical setting, which allows you to immerse yourself in a world of sun, sand, and secrets. The game's narrative is very interesting, and features a branching storyline, giving the players a lot of choices that affect the outcomes of the story. The main focus of the game is relationship building. As players interact with different characters, they will be given choices that will shape the story, and have an impact on the relationships. The game's adult content adds to the experience, with well-made scenes. The art style is also very well done and adds to the game’s unique aesthetic. The story keeps players engaged with the gameplay, and keeps them invested to see the various outcomes. Paradise Lust is available on PC, and it is a popular alternative for those looking for something like Summertime Saga.

4. Harem Hotel

Harem Hotel offers a story where you manage a hotel. This game has a unique premise, which allows for unique gameplay experiences. As the manager, you have the ability to interact with the guests. Harem Hotel also features a lot of adult content, and the game has a lot of content as well, which is updated regularly. You can build relationships with the guests, and you can also upgrade the hotel with the money you earn. The gameplay offers a good blend of resource management and narrative, keeping the players engaged. Harem Hotel offers a lot of content, and the game's updates have kept players coming back for more.
